The height of the right circular cylinder with volume of 500π cubic centimetre and radius of 5 centimetre is 20 cm.
<h3>Volume of a cylinder</h3>
volume = πr²h
where
Therefore,
volume = 500π cm³
r = 5 cm
Therefore,
volume of the cylinder = πr²h
500π = 5²πh
500π = 25πh
divide both sides by 25π
500π / 25π = 25πh / 25π
h = 20 cm
